Robot umpires are coming to the big leagues in 2026 after Major League Baseball’s 11-man competition committee on Tuesday approved use of the Automated Ball/Strike System.

Major League Baseball announced on Sept. 23 that the ABS challenge system was approved for MLB play by a vote of the joint competition committee.
